Working Principle of Asbestos Powder Conveying Lines

The core of an asbestos powder material conveying line is a system designed to transport fine asbestos powder from a storage or processing area to a designated destination, such as a processing unit or storage silo. The system typically integrates several key components, including a hopper for material storage, a conveyor mechanism (often a screw conveyor or pneumatic conveyor), and control systems for regulating flow and speed. The working principle revolves around the controlled movement of the powder through these components, ensuring minimal dust generation and efficient material transfer.

Operation Process of the Asbestos Powder Conveying Line

The operation of the asbestos powder conveying line begins with the loading of the material into the hopper. The hopper is equipped with a feeding mechanism, such as a rotary valve or a feeder, which controls the flow rate of the powder into the conveyor. Once the material is fed into the conveyor, it is transported through the system. For screw conveyors, the rotating screw pushes the powder forward, while pneumatic conveyors use air pressure to move the material through a pipeline. The system may include intermediate storage or mixing units to ensure consistent material quality. At the end of the line, the powder is discharged into a silo or processing equipment. The entire process is monitored by a control panel that adjusts parameters like speed and pressure to maintain optimal performance and safety.

Key Components and Their Functions

Several critical components contribute to the effective operation of the asbestos powder conveying line. The hopper serves as the primary storage vessel, with a design that minimizes material buildup and reduces the risk of dust accumulation. The feeder, often a rotary valve, regulates the flow of powder into the conveyor, preventing overloading and ensuring a steady supply. The conveyor itself—whether a screw or pneumatic type—transports the material. Screw conveyors are suitable for dry, free-flowing materials and provide a positive displacement method, while pneumatic conveyors use air to move the powder, which is ideal for handling fine or dusty materials. The control system manages the entire operation, including speed adjustments, pressure monitoring, and safety interlocks to prevent accidents.

Ensuring Safety and Efficiency in Material Handling

Handling asbestos powder requires strict adherence to safety protocols due to the health risks associated with asbestos fibers. The conveying line is designed with features that minimize dust exposure, such as enclosed systems and dust collection units. The control system includes safety interlocks that stop the conveyor if a component fails or if there is an abnormal pressure or temperature reading. Efficiency is enhanced through the use of variable speed drives, which adjust the conveyor speed based on the material load, reducing energy consumption and wear on the equipment. Regular maintenance, including cleaning and inspection of components, is essential to maintain the system's performance and longevity.
